使用数据库管理软件的基础知识学习SQL的最佳途径是什么

时间:2025-04-21 03:27:51 分类:电脑软件

掌握SQL的基础知识对于任何希望进入数据管理和分析领域的人员来说都是至关重要的。SQL(结构化查询语言)被广泛用于各种数据库管理系统,它使用户能够高效地操作和检索数据。在选择最佳学习途径时,以下几个方面值得关注。

使用数据库管理软件的基础知识学习SQL的最佳途径是什么

选择合适的数据库管理软件至关重要。现今市场上出现了多种免费和付费的数据库管理工具,如MySQL、PostgreSQL和SQLite等。各个软件在功能和用户友好性上有所不同,For Beginners 来说, SQLite因其轻量和易于部署而备受青睐。简单的安装和配置过程能够让学习者迅速上手,更加专注于SQL的学习。

线上课程是学习SQL的另一种有效方式。很多平台,如Coursera、Udemy以及edX提供了结构化的课程,包括视频讲解、练习和社区支持。而且,这些平台通常会提供从初级到高级的课程设置,便于学习者根据自己的进度和水平选择。完成这些课程后,进行项目实践是巩固知识的最佳途径,可以仿照课程中的案例,创建相关的数据库以进行练习。

参与开发者社区和论坛也是进步的重要途径。在Stack Overflow、Reddit等论坛上,与其他学习者和专业人士互动,能够获得不同视角的洞见。通过提问、回答问题,甚至是参与开源项目,可以加深对SQL的理解与运用。定期参与线下的技术交流活动,可以扩大人脉并获取更多的学习资源。

重要的是,要养成良好的学习习惯和实际操作的习惯。每天都可以抽出固定的时间温习SQL语法、构建数据库和编写查询。应用不同的练习平台,如LeetCode、HackerRank等,不同的练习挑战可以帮助你逐渐提高SQL技能。进行代码复习和参与小组学习也能有效提升自身的水平。

为了更好地学习SQL,定期跟进市场和技术趋势十分重要。随着新的技术和工具不断涌现,保持对新事物的敏感性将会使自己的技能始终保持竞争力。定期阅读行业博客、参与网络研讨会以及关注相关的技术书籍都是不错的选择。

FAQ:

1. 什么是SQL,为什么学习它非常重要?

SQL是用于管理和查询数据库的标准语言,掌握它可以帮助用户有效地处理数据,广泛应用于互联网、商业和科学研究等领域。

2. 学习SQL需要多长时间?

学习SQL的时间因人而异,基础知识通常可以在几周内掌握,但深入理解和熟练运用可能需要几个月的时间。

3. 有哪些推荐的学习资源?

推荐使用在线学习平台如Coursera、Udemy、Codecademy以及书籍《SQL Fundamentals》和《Learning SQL》等。

4. 初学者应该先学习哪些SQL基本概念?

初学者应首先了解数据库的结构、基本的SELECT、INSERT、UPDATE和DELETE语句,以及数据过滤和排序的重要性。

5. 是否需要安装特定的软件来学习SQL?

虽然可以使用在线SQL编辑器进行基本操作,但安装本地数据库管理软件,如MySQL或SQLite,有助于深入理解和实践。